As the thunder of the bright net mainstream ran over the news about the arrest by CBA officers of Janusz Palikot. erstwhile politician of the Civic Platform, leader of the Palikot Movement and your D.A.'s Movement have placed 8 counts of committing crimes against respective 1000 people. The case concerns the bringing to an adverse regulation the property of the victims of about PLN 70 million. Thus, the dream dream of the “king of sparkling wines” of spectacular success in the alcohol manufacture became a collective nightmare. Why?

The past of an empire disaster created by scandalous politics began a fewer years ago. Following further election failures Palikot decided to return to business. Purchased from Mark Jakubiak in 2018, Browar Tenczynek was the beginning of a fresh venture. It consisted in raising money for the improvement of the task from crowdfunding collections, offering any benefits to lenders in return. The amount of amounts entrusted to a widely recognized character was driven by another people to invest in the thought of a business gig.

We can already say present that the measurement of "success" of the entrepreneur was his current debt. According to various data, Palikot took between 200 and 300 million PLN out of his pocket. At the moment, everything indicates that the alcohol ship commanded by Palikot will sink. The “Krzyżyk” was most likely 1 of the creditors on the entrepreneur’s venture. According to information available in the National Debt Register, the Krakow court on 30 September 2024, i.e. a fewer days before the detention of the erstwhile MP, secured the company's assets by establishing a temporary judicial supervisor. As the Business Insider explained in the text of Friday 4 October, “the setting up of a temporary judicial supervisor serves to safe the debtor’s assets at the phase of the insolvency and restructuring application. The primary task of the supervisor is to decently safe the debtor's assets during the proceedings. This concerns both the examination of the application for bankruptcy and the conduct of restructuring proceedings.’
